Working Principle of Diesel Generators
Diesel generators operate on the principle of converting mechanical energy into electrical energy through the combustion of diesel fuel. The main components of a diesel generator include the engine, alternator, fuel system, cooling system, exhaust system, and control panel. When the generator is started, the diesel fuel is injected into the combustion chamber, where it ignites and drives the piston to turn the crankshaft. This rotation generates electricity through the alternator, which is then distributed to the electrical load.

Considerations for Choosing a Diesel Generator
When selecting a diesel generator for voltage support, several factors need to be taken into account to ensure that the generator meets your specific requirements. The first consideration is the power rating of the generator, which should be sufficient to handle the total electrical load of the connected equipment. It is essential to calculate the peak power demand and select a generator with a suitable capacity to prevent overloading. Additionally, the fuel efficiency, noise level, maintenance requirements, and reliability of the generator should be evaluated to determine its suitability for the intended application. Furthermore, factors such as the availability of spare parts, warranty coverage, and after-sales support should be considered to ensure long-term performance and peace of mind.
